Italy - Smoking Prevalence

Since 2014, Italy Smoking Prevalence was down by 0.4points year on year. At 19.3 Percent of Persons Aged 15+ Who Are Daily Smokers in 2019, the country was ranked number 3 comparing other countries in Smoking Prevalence. Italy is overtaken by Estonia, which was ranked number 2 at 20 Percent of Persons Aged 15+ Who Are Daily Smokers and is followed by South Africa with 19 Percent of Persons Aged 15+ Who Are Daily Smokers. Turkey lead the ranking with 25.9 Percent of Persons Aged 15+ Who Are Daily Smokers in 2019, that is a fall of 0.8points compared to 2018. Israel witnessed the best average annual growth at +1.1points per year, while Brazil recorded the worst performance at -9.4points per year.
